      Amid protests by farmers against the new farm laws, Punjab Chief Minister Captain Amarinder Singh Tuesday said he was prepared to ‘resign or be dismissed rather than bow to injustice towards Punjab’s farmers’. Captain also warned of possible disruption to state’s peace and a threat to national security as a result of the farm laws, pointing out that nobody can tolerate religious hurt and attack on livelihood. Cautioning the Centre against allowing the situation to get out of hand, the chief minister said if the farm laws are not revoked, angry youth would take to streets and join the farmers, which would lead to chaos.
